Description
18th/19th C. whale bone busk with fine two color (red and green) two-sided scrimshaw decoration. Primary decoration depicting a heart over flowering potted plant, tombstone with weeping willow tree, and 12-pointed star over house. Bordered with triangular geometrical design. Back side decorated with flowering vine and rectangular cartouche, 10.25”H x 1.5”W. Busks are long, flat slices out of whalebone ribs that whaling crews decorated with carvings and then gave to their wives or sweethearts once they were back on land after a voyage. Busks were slipped into vertical pocket in ladies’ corsets to stiffen the garment.
